Discounted Electric Vehicle Charging at Q-Park

Q-Park are delighted to be able to partner with Franklin Energy to provide a discount on Electric Vehicle Charging using the Franklin LiFe Network in Q-Park car parks.

Q-Park house 256 charging points throughout the UK which continues to grow rapidly with the Franklin Energy collaboration. These are used by several different types of Q-Park customer, whether it be commuters charging whilst at work or visitors enjoying a leisure trip.

With the further loosening of COVID Restrictions across the UK from the 17th May, Q-Park and Franklin Energy have joined forces to provide a 10% discount on all Electric Vehicle charging with Franklin Energy in Q-Park car parks. This offer will be available until the 17th June and is seen as yet another way that Q-Park are working together with their strategic partners to help drive footfall back into city centres.

About Q-Park

Q-Park is one of the three leading providers of parking facilities in West Europe, whether wholly-owned, leased, managed or in a hybrid business model.  Q-Park is notable for its quality approach and has a portfolio comprising over 547,000 parking spaces in the Netherlands, Germany, Belgium, Great Britain, France, Ireland and Denmark.
